And so it begins

Julianna is sitting on a potty.  We’ve been toying with this idea for a while, even though I KNOW that it’s probably too early.   Both Jessie and Sam potty trained when they were about three and a half, and they did it on their own in a day or two.  I know it’s possible to get them to do it earlier, but it always seemed to me that it was more about the parents wanting it and if you wait until the child is ready, it’s so much easier.  So why did I get a potty for my just barely two year old daughter??  I don’t know.  Rationally, I know it’s a waste of time, but still…

She’s dry when she wakes up in the morning, and has started telling me when she poops.  So why not, right?  Even if I don’t push it at all, but just have the potty here, around, hanging out if she wants it for a while.  She seemed interested in the thought of having her own potty – until we actually got it.  Then she insisted that she didn’t want her own potty.  So, in a flash of brilliant parenting, I told her that it wasn’t hers – it was G’s (she still called Jessie “G”).  And as a little sister, there’s nothing she likes more than taking stuff from her sister.  Now I just have to convince nine year old to pretend that the little purple and pink toddler potty belongs to her 🙂
